uWSGI
uWSGI je webový aplikační server. Je pojmenovaný po rozhraní WSGI, které bylo jeho prvním podporovaným modulem a je rozhraním mezi webovým servrem a webovými aplikacemi napsanými v Pythonu. Kombinace pythonské aplikace s webovým serverem (např. Nginx nebo Cherokee, které uWSGI přímo podporují) je typické prostředí, ve kterém je uWSGI nasazováno. Z hlediska webového serveru Apache přinesl uWSGI oproti staršímu mod_wsgi několik výhod, mj. možnost různých prostředí pro různé aplikace.[1] Podporuje běžné webové aplikační frameworky jako je Django a Flask a aplikace pro něj je možné kromě Pythonu napsat v Perlu a Ruby.
Aktuální verze | 2.0.28 (26. října 2024) |
---|---|
Vyvíjeno v | C |
Typ softwaru | webový server, svobodný a otevřený software a knihovna Pythonu |
Licence | GPL linking exception |
Web | uwsgi-docs |
Některá data mohou pocházet z datové položky. |
Software uWSGI je napsaný v Céčku a distribuovaný pod licencí GNU GPL, jedná se tedy o svobodný software.
Odkazy
editovatReference
editovatV tomto článku byl použit překlad textu z článku uWSGI na německé Wikipedii.
- ↑ ŠTRAUCH, Adam. Hostujeme Python weby bezpečně a flexibilně s uWSGI. Root.cz [online]. 2011-04-01. Dostupné online. ISSN 1212-8309.